

As a tennis shop owner, having used and sold many replacement grips, I consider the Klipper brand as one of the best. All their grips have the right amount of feel, tackiness, comfort and durability. In my opinion, an overgrip is not needed. In fact, a Klipper grip, properly installed, will improve your game more than a new string job. All that is needed to keep your Klipper grip in like new condition is to wipe your grip from the top to the butt end with a warm water, wrung out, wash cloth. This will cleanse the grip of soil and perspiration. To sum it up, any style grip by Klipper will serve you well, and will further your enjoyment of TENNIS, THE GRANDEST SPORT OF ALL.
